This flavorful Harvest Chicken Skillet is a complete meal packed with protein, fiber, and vibrant veggies! With tender chicken, crispy bacon, caramelized Brussels sprouts, sweet potatoes, and tart Granny Smith apples, it’s a delicious, healthy dish approved for both Paleo and Whole30 diets. All cooked in one pan for minimal cleanup, this recipe is perfect for busy weeknights or meal prepping.
Ingredients
- 1 tbsp olive oil
- 1 lb boneless, skinless chicken breasts (cut into cubes)
- 1 tsp kosher salt, divided
- ½ tsp ground black pepper
- 4 slices thick-cut bacon (chopped)
- 3 cups Brussels sprouts (trimmed and quartered)
- 1 medium sweet potato (peeled and cubed)
- 1 medium onion (chopped)
- 2 Granny Smith apples (peeled, cored, and cubed)
- 4 cloves garlic (minced)
- 2 tsp fresh thyme (or ½ tsp dried thyme)
- 1 tsp ground cinnamon
- 1 cup reduced-sodium chicken broth (divided)

Instructions
- Cook the Chicken: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ium-high heat. Add chicken cubes, salt, and pepper. Cook until browned and cooked through (about 5 minutes). Remove and set aside.
- Cook the Bacon: In the same skillet, reduce heat to medium-low and cook bacon until crispy (about 8 minutes). Remove bacon and set aside, leaving 1 ½ tbsp of bacon drippings.
- Cook Veggies: Increase heat to medium-high. Add Brussels sprouts, sweet potato, and onion. Cook until veggies are tender and onions are translucent (about 10 minutes).
- Add Apples and Spices: Stir in apples, garlic, thyme, and cinnamon. Cook for 30 seconds, then pour in ½ cup chicken broth. Let simmer until evaporated (about 2 minutes).
- Combine and Serve: Add the reserved chicken, the remaining broth, and cook for 2 minutes until heated through. Stir in the bacon and serve warm.
Notes:
- Storage: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Reheat gently on the stovetop with a splash of chicken broth.
- Customization: Feel free to add more spices or veggies to suit your taste!
Nutrition (Per Serving):
- Calories: 397kcal
- Carbs: 35g
- Protein: 31g
- Fat: 16g
- Fiber: 7g
- Sugar: 15g
- Vitamin A: 8656 IU
- Vitamin C: 68 mg
